Road cycling routes around Dovecliffe Woods are situated within the green belt of Barnsley, South Yorkshire, offering a natural setting for outdoor activities. The area features a lush woodland environment and is located near the River Dearne valley. The landscape combines flat stretches with undulating terrain, providing varied road cycling experiences. This region is integrated into a wider network of rural features designed for recreation.

Conisbrough Castle is a 12th-century medieval fortification in Conisbrough, South Yorkshire, England, known for its imposing keep. The castle was initially built by William de Warenne, the Earl of Surrey, following the Norman Conquest. It was later rebuilt in stone, including the 28-meter (92 ft) high keep, by Hamelin Plantagenet. The castle's unique cylindrical keep, supported by six massive buttresses, is a prominent feature of the local landscape.

Frequently Asked Questions

What kind of terrain can I expect on road cycling routes around Dovecliffe Woods?

The road cycling routes around Dovecliffe Woods offer a varied landscape. You'll find a mix of mostly well-paved surfaces, combining flat stretches with undulating terrain. The area is characterized by its beautiful woodland environment and proximity to the River Dearne valley, providing scenic views throughout your ride.

Are there road cycling routes suitable for beginners or those looking for an easy ride?

Yes, Dovecliffe Woods offers several easy road cycling routes. For instance, the Cathill Road loop from Wombwell is an easy 28.6 km trail with moderate elevation, making it a great option for a leisurely ride. There are 32 easy routes in total, perfect for those new to road cycling or seeking a relaxed experience.
